Twilight Time Blu-ray: The Purple Rose of Cairo 1985



The Purple Rose of Cairo (1985)

Blu-ray Company Release: Twilight Time

Starring: Mia Farrow, Jeff Daniels, Danny Aiello, Van Johnson, Edward Herrmann, John Wood, Zoe Caldwell

Plot: In 1930's New Jersey, Depressed during the Depression, a downtrodden housewife/waitress finds her world turned upside down when her favorite movie star literally steps down from the screen with decidedly romantic intentions.

Wonderful acting by the whole ensemble cast. Mia Farrow is absolutely wonderful as she always is in anything she ever does. She is the main lead character Cecilia who is down in luck and stuck in a marriage with an abusive, womanizing husband, named Monk, played by the wonderful actor and master talent Danny Aiello.

To pass the time she spends watching movies in the cinema to rid herself of her pain and the horror at her home. She becomes infatuated and lost in the fantasy of cinema, (sounds like my life). Soon the theater shows a film titled, The Purple Rose of Cairo, and Cecilia becomes enthralled with the story and the male character of Tom Baxter played wonderfully by Jeff Daniels. Soon to her shock and surprise after sitting watching the movie many times, one day Tom Baxter notices her and walks out from the movie.

Something that massively stands out in this picture is cinematography by Gordon Willis. Willis was a god at his craft. Best known for his unique style. He mastered such films as The Godfather series and many Woody Allen pictures. Movie buffs, movie geeks need to know Willis was the sophisticated one that crafted and brought so much to the film world. His movies look like nothing before. He created a whole new atmosphere and gave it to the film world. Originality through his lighting and lens and structure of capturing the film the way it needed to be told is a mastery at its finest and The Purple Rose of Cairo is no different.

Another aspect about this movie is the music score by music master Richard Hyman. His 50 year career has spanned all aspects of the music world. His craft in movies and albums and countless concerts has left a perfectly woven mastery that only his touch has formed. He is a stable in Woody Allen films. Composing over ten of Allen's features. What makes Hyman so unique is his various styles of music from classic to electronic to jazz and everything in-between.

Audio/Video: 

Audio: 4/5
Video: 4/5

I have never seen this film so all I can say is there is some grain or dust in spots that I did notice on this Blu-ray which confused me a little on its overall quality. It's nothing major but it is noticeable at times, but does not destroy the beauty of the film. The sound is crisp and the colors and images are vibrant at times and the whole film works. Not seen it before, it’s like a brand new feature. I absolutely loved the overall quality of the film even with its spots, which is minor.

LANGUAGE: English
VIDEO: 1080p High Definition / 1.85:1
AUDIO: English 1.0 DTS-HD MA
SUBTITLES: English SDH

Extras: 2/5

Not much here but you do get a fantastic special feature that most Twilight Time Blu-ray’s come with the wonderful Isolated music track. Always a fantastic listen. I being a huge music lover and movie lover; it’s like a complete "Have your cake and eat it to".

Plus you get the wonderful booklet by film historian Julie Kirgo which is always a wonderful added bonus.

Also the Original Theatrical Trailer.
